One problem for me is the lack to much help for Midi output in particular for 
various repeats. I find that some of the structures
that work for printed output do not work for Midi output. I have settled into 
using the basic repeat volta 2 {  

                  }

                  \alternative {

                      {..}

                      {..}

                   }

Which with unfolding works well for both midi and print.

 

However when it comes to the classical Minuet and Trio form I am stumped. Is it 
possible to produce all the various repeats in a
Midi file with the final minuet played without repeats to "fine".
